Oracle DBA Position Requirements:- Qualification:- BACHELOR OF COMPUTER SCIENCE
Essential Job Functions:-
• Evaluate patch releases from Oracle and patching requests from development, and communicating constraints, issues, and timelines for deployment.
• Change management including maintenance of multiple development, test, QA, and production environments. Responsible for deploying approved changes to production.
• Provide 24x7 rotational on-call support, including driving Root Cause Analysis (RCA), Preventative action follow-though, and participation in weekly operations reviews.
• Provide proactive database monitoring and issue resolution
• Perform database and PL/SQL optimization including performance tuning, query optimization and supportability.
• Participate and contribute to projects involving enterprise systems enhancements.
• Perform Implementation and ongoing support of high availability architecture (standby logical/physical Data Guard, RAC, hot standby databases, etc.)
• Work with development project teams to design and implement database solutions to meet business requirements.
• Participate in project design and Oracle database design decisions. Refine and troubleshoot the design.
• Create and maintain appropriate documentation about the database and the data architecture.
• Support of the nightly ETL processing
• Ensure regular proactive capacity planning and tending reviews of all oracle databases. Producing weekly, monthly management reports.
• Attend project kick-offs and design reviews as necessary to appropriately size new environments, recommend infrastructure solutions and deliver associated cost and resource effort estimates
• Develop and implement Database security polices and procedures, in line with corporate objectives
